Ok guys, we constructed a area of 25 ft wide by 40 ft uphill yesterday. The rocks are anywhere from 6 inches to 36 inches. The grade ranges from 5 degrees to maybe 40 degrees at the top. Had to make some rough stuff for supers. We are still moving small rocks around to get some good trail though the course.I had a hard time w/ my 2.2 clod in some spots. We have to get about 2 more (pick-up truck size loads) of rock also. there are some lighter spots. We were all tired yesterday after getting the off-road track ready, or we would have done it then. I have not made bridges yet, but in the next couple weeks will have that done. Also we did not put river bed in yet, still discussing how it's gonna be done and with what materials. We're looking at lanscape stuff. Looks like track will be open on sundays for practice. We're not going to hold any comps for awhile. Maybe mid summer, that will change. There is plenty of pit space. I think Alton will let people hook to electric. There are port-a-johns on site. Also water is available. There pry will be a fee, even for practice. There is plenty of pit space, room to put up canopies,tables, trailers, whatever.My phone went dead yesterday before we got done so, I don't have pics yet. Give me 2-3 days.
